0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

西门子要将LAD指令与PLC变量互连

机器人及PLC自动化应用 来源:机器人及PLC自动化应用 作者:机器人及PLC自动化 2022-04-27 16:10 次阅读

TIA Portal 中,可以在程序段中创建用户程序时直接创建变量。 以下步骤介绍了如何定义 PLC 变量以及将插入的 LAD 指令与 PLC 变量互连。LAD 指令根据变量值执行,以此来控制机器的启动和关闭。

打开组织块“Main [OB1]” 的第一个程序段。

2. 在常开触点的操作数占位符中输入名称 "ON_OFF_Switch" 。

a061abda-c582-11ec-bce3-dac502259ad0.png

3. 按回车键确认输入内容。

a076c4ca-c582-11ec-bce3-dac502259ad0.png

4. 打开“定义变量”(Define tag) 对话框。

a089b31e-c582-11ec-bce3-dac502259ad0.png

5. 定义 "ON_OFF_Switch" 变量。

a0a177d8-c582-11ec-bce3-dac502259ad0.png

6. 在“输出线圈” 指令的操作数占位符中输入名称 "ON" 。

a0afe930-c582-11ec-bce3-dac502259ad0.png

7. 按回车键确认输入内容。

8. 打开“定义变量”(Define tag) 对话框。

a0c0e4a6-c582-11ec-bce3-dac502259ad0.png

9. 定义“ON”变量。

a0d72536-c582-11ec-bce3-dac502259ad0.png

10. 在“取反线圈” 指令的操作数占位符中输入名称 "OFF" 并定义相应变量。

11. 单击工具栏上的“保存”(Save) 按钮以保存该项目。

结果

编写了一个打开和关闭实例机器的按钮开关程序。

a0ec65d6-c582-11ec-bce3-dac502259ad0.png

操作此按钮开关将产生如下效果:

● 按一次按钮开关,"ON_OFF_Switch" 变量设置为信号状态“1”。

– 信号流开始传递,并且“输出线圈”指令将 "ON" 变量设置为信号状态“1”。

– 机器启动。

– "OFF" 变量的信号状态为“0”,不再起作用。

● 再按一次按钮开关,"ON_OFF_Switch" 变量设置为信号状态“0”。

电流中断,并且“取反线圈”指令将 "OFF" 变量设置为信号状态“1”。

– 机器关闭。

– "ON" 变量的信号状态为“0”,不再起作用。

审核编辑 :李倩

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• plc
    plc
    +关注

    关注

    5011

    文章

    13290

    浏览量

    463263
  • 西门子
    +关注

    关注

    94

    文章

    3039

    浏览量

    115852
  • 程序
    +关注

    关注

    117

    文章

    3787

    浏览量

    81031
  • 变量
    +关注

    关注

    0

    文章

    613

    浏览量

    28366

原文标题:西门子 要将 LAD 指令与 PLC 变量互连

文章出处:【微信号:gh_a8b121171b08,微信公众号:机器人及PLC自动化应用】欢迎添加关注!文章转载请注明出处。

收藏 人收藏

    评论

    相关推荐

    西门子plc200编程实例详解

    S7-200系列包括多种不同型号的CPU模块和扩展模块,可以根据具体的应用需求进行选择和配置。其主要特点包括:高性能的CPU、丰富的指令集、强大的网络通信功能以及易于使用的编程软件等。 在编程方面,西门子PLC S7-200支
    的头像 发表于 10-22 14:38 663次阅读

    西门子PLC的复位操作

    西门子PLC(Programmable Logic Controller,可编程逻辑控制器)是一种广泛应用于工业自动化领域的控制设备。在实际应用过程中,有时需要对PLC进行复位操作,以解决一些程序
    的头像 发表于 08-16 17:46 3176次阅读

    西门子移位指令怎么用在顺序控制

    西门子PLC(可编程逻辑控制器)广泛应用于工业自动化领域,其指令集丰富,能够满足各种控制需求。在顺序控制中,移位指令是一种非常有用的指令
    的头像 发表于 08-16 17:08 919次阅读

    西门子PLC与IO模块如何通讯

    在现代工业自动化控制系统中,西门子PLC(Programmable Logic Controller)以其卓越的性能和稳定性赢得了广泛应用。而在西门子PLC系统中,IO模块(Input
    的头像 发表于 06-19 10:46 1965次阅读

    西门子S7-1200 PLC指令介绍

    西门子S7-1200 PLC,作为西门子自动化控制产品中的一款紧凑型控制器,凭借其强大的功能和易用性,在工业控制领域得到了广泛的应用。S7-1200 PLC不仅具备标准的
    的头像 发表于 06-18 14:52 2758次阅读

    西门子PLC中OB块的功能详解

    西门子PLC(Programmable Logic Controller)作为工业自动化领域的核心设备,其内部功能强大、应用广泛。在西门子PLC中,OB块(Organization B
    的头像 发表于 06-15 11:27 4689次阅读

    西门子PLC的作用和工作原理

    在工业自动化领域中,可编程逻辑控制器(Programmable Logic Controller,简称PLC)扮演着至关重要的角色。西门子PLC,作为PLC市场中的佼佼者,凭借其卓越的
    的头像 发表于 06-15 11:26 2224次阅读

    西门子PLC的发展历史

    西门子,作为全球知名的工业自动化和数字化企业,其PLC(可编程逻辑控制器)产品的发展历程是工业自动化领域的重要篇章。从早期的二进制控制器到如今的智能化、网络化控制系统,西门子PLC的发
    的头像 发表于 06-15 11:26 1933次阅读

    西门子PLC总线故障怎么解决

    在工业自动化领域,西门子PLC(Programmable Logic Controller,可编程逻辑控制器)以其高可靠性、强稳定性和丰富的功能而备受青睐。然而,在实际应用中,PLC总线故障时有发生
    的头像 发表于 06-13 18:18 2363次阅读

    西门子plc的多轴控制能力介绍

    西门子PLC(Programmable Logic Controller,可编程逻辑控制器)是一种广泛应用于工业自动化领域的控制设备。它可以根据不同的控制需求,实现对各种机械设备的精确控制。在多轴
    的头像 发表于 06-12 11:14 1268次阅读

    西门子plc模块型号详解

    西门子PLC(Programmable Logic Controller,可编程逻辑控制器)是工业自动化领域中非常重要的一种设备,其模块化的设计使得其应用范围非常广泛。本文将详细介绍西门子PL
    的头像 发表于 06-11 16:18 5971次阅读

    三菱or西门子品牌PLC的区别

    三菱PLC是日系品牌,编程直观易懂,学习起来会比较轻松,但指令较多。而西门子PLC是德国品牌,指令比较抽象,学习难度较大,但
    发表于 02-20 14:09 545次阅读

    西门子PLC和三菱PLC哪个好?如何进行数据采集?

    西门子PLC和三菱PLC是工业现场中常见的自动化控制设备。西门子PLC是德国品牌,编程简单、指令
    的头像 发表于 02-06 10:34 801次阅读

    西门子PLC和施耐德PLC区别

    西门子PLC系统的设计、建造工作量小,维护方便,容易改造,西门子PLC用存储逻辑代替接线逻辑,大大减少了控制设备外部的接线,使控制系统设计及建造的周期大为缩短,同时维护也变得容易起来。
    发表于 01-17 10:14 2100次阅读

    西门子博途:如何定义PLC变量

    在 TIA Portal 中,可以在程序段中创建用户程序时直接创建变量。 以下步骤介绍了如何定义 PLC 变量以及将插入的 LAD 指令
    发表于 12-29 18:10 2228次阅读
    <b class='flag-5'>西门子</b>博途:如何定义<b class='flag-5'>PLC</b><b class='flag-5'>变量</b>